Early Career and Stand Up Breakthrough
Brian Regan began performing in comedy clubs during the late 1980s and early 1990s, gradually refining his clean, relatable material. His breakthrough came with a series of televised stand up appearances, which highlighted his affable stage persona and precise timing.
Specials, Live Tours, and Audience Reach
Over the years, Regan has released multiple stand up specials, each drawing large audiences who appreciate his family friendly approach. His live tours consistently sell out in mid sized venues, demonstrating how his reliable brand of humor translates into consistent ticket revenue.

Television, Film, and Media Appearances
Beyond stand up, Brian Regan has appeared in television shows, sitcoms, and movies, expanding his visibility and income streams. These roles rarely dominate his career but provide steady ancillary earnings.
